Cook and drain your tortellini and cut your veggies if you haven’t already.
In a large mixing bowl, toss your tortellini, zucchini, red onion, spinach, Italian dressing, and Parmesan cheese until the ingredients are evenly distributed.
Serve and enjoy!
Notes
You can use any kind of tortellini for this recipe. We like to use Giovanni Rana.
Other veggies you can use include black/ green olives, cucumber, broccoli, and butternut squash.
Store your salad in the mixing bowl covered with plastic wrap or transfer it to an airtight container. Your salad will be good in the fridge for up to 5 days.
If you know you are going to be storing your salad then you will want to omit the dressing and drizzle it over individual servings of salad. This will help prevent the baby spinach from getting soggy in the fridge.
We like to top our salad with extra tomatoes or Parmesan cheese.
You can cut your tomatoes in half or quarter them.
